Hackers cripple major conservative blogs

Posted By Matt Bramanti On 28th April 2006 @ 10:30 In Crime, International, Politics, Blogging | 3 Comments

So much for the marketplace of ideas. This morning, web hosting company Hosting Matters was struck with a major [1] denial-of-service attack, knocking several high-profile conservative blogs offline.

In the past, Hosting Matters has demonstrated its ability to prevent and respond to DoS attacks. Accordingly, it’s become home to a large concentration of right-thinking, high-traffic blogs, including our beloved Lone Star Times.

It looks like these attacks are the work of overseas hackers. So says Hosting Matters:

Well, we know who the target is, and we know where the likely source of the attack originates…and I sincerely doubt that country’s leadership has the least bit of concern for extraditing over something like this.

UPDATE (11:35 a.m.): The sites are back up. According to the Hosting Matters [15] support forums, it looks like the attack originated from Saudi Arabia. HM personnel [16] won’t release the name of the site targeted by the Islamofascist hackers, but Michelle says it’s [17] Aaron’s CC, which is still down.
